procede is out, it's not a 15 removal, removing all the electrical tape took a long time especially you have to be very careful with the male pins, so tiny could easily bend and break, one of my male pins is bent and i wouldnt dare to bend it back, i marked everything on the procede wires now so it will probably take 30 min to put back everything, i hate to create new thread like this too but wasnt sure if they will need to access the ecu to reset the light. anyways, thread is closed.............

Try to reset it; if it doesn't reset that means it's an active fault and the dealer is gonna have to update it to v.29.2. Take it out before you bring it in, your SA will thank you for saving them the headache. TRUST me I've been through it. If you have a pre-doomsday V3 harness let me know if you are interested in the pinout diagram (I wrote it down while I was taking it out for future reference).
